Chapter 11



Mason Miller





"Looks like Ezra was right. Those bastards still haven't changed their base. Stupidos." I whispered to the small earpiece. Ezra and Liam were still inside the car waiting for my signal.

In front of the abandoned building were two armed man, chatting in Italian about their last visit to the pub. I sat on the tree branch, watching. There's no doubt about it, they're the ones who have Jace. From here, I could see their tattoos, a fierce looking black eagle, right beside it was a number. The man on the right was number 203 and the other was 148. This number usually signifies that they were the 203rd and 148th person to join the gang. Means they were quite experienced. Currently, Aquile Neres has over 400 members in all of the country.

"Well, we're going in. Mace stay outside on the lookout." Ezra said.

"Hey! No fair! This wasn't according to plan! Why are you two the only ones to do the fighting. I want to be in the action too!" I whispered angrily, if that was possible, over the mouthpiece. I want to be in the rescue force too!

"No, you have to be there to inform us if ever they try to escape or they call for help." Ezra said again ever so heartlessly. I could hear the guns being loaded in the back. "Ready, Liam?" Ezra asked.

"Fine. I'll stay put. I always do this job. Why don't you—"

"Quit yapping will you or they notice you." Ezra said again. Damn, he's really trying to piss me off is he. How come they get to do all the action, well whatever. At least I won't have to worry about my beautiful face getting hurt.

"Let's go, Ezra." I heard Liam said from the back, and judging from his voice, man. Poor eagles.

Liam rarely goes serious when dealing with small gangs like Aquile Neres. And whenever he does get serious, he makes sure to bring them down to ashes. Literally.

A few moments later, I saw the car door opening and Liam got down first. Ezra followed quietly. The two thugs in the front were still chatting happily when Liam ghostly appeared behind them and did the honour of putting them to sleep in this ungodly hour. I mean he did his super fast hand chop and the two immediately fell to the ground.

Ezra merely followed behind him and before continuing, Liam turned around and looked directly at me. For a moment I was stunned that he was able to find me so quickly, but then again, it's Liam we're talking about. He pressed his two fingers on to the earpiece and spoke.

"You can come here and guard the front Mace." he said, sounding like he was giving me an order which annoyed me even more. These two always tell me what to do. Am I their servant? They should be thankful that I'm kind enough to do what they tell me to. Tch.

I jumped down from the tree and ran discretely to the front of the building, making sure that no one saw me.

"You two selfish jerks. You better make sure you get the kid." I said quite annoyed and saw Liam sneak a small amused smile.

"You don't have to tell us that, Macey." he said as he turned away and headed to the building. My blood boiled once more.

"I told you, don't call me that!" I threw back, but they were already inside.









Ezra Walker 


Liam's smirk disappeared as we entered the building. His eyes had a dangerous glint which I've only seen once. 

Liam was never serious when it came to dealing with small underlings like Aquile Neres. After all, it wasn't worth the time and effort to deal with these guys. Groups like these are usually controlled by a larger gang or mafia. They cannot survive on their own. It was better to deal with whoever was ordering them to do the dirty work and teach them a lesson; to never mess with the Parkers. 

The walls of the building was scribbled with black eagles, a sign that the building belonged to them. Looking at them, my mind flew to my younger years when I had joined this group to rebel against my parents. 

I started as a regular member, but quickly rose to a high rank and eventually, held an important position at the mafia group that was controlling Aquile Neres. Those were all a long time ago, but I still remember how they operate which is why Liam and I were heading to the basement where they usually held their hostages captive. 

As we were walking down the stairs, our steps were as quiet as a leaf falling on the ground. We stopped briefly when we heard men speaking.

"Man, I can't take this atmosphere. So intense." one said. 

"Tell me 'bout it. But the boss must be getting desperate if he resorts to kidnapping--" before he could finish his sentence, he dropped to the ground. Soon, his colleague collapsed. My eyes searched for Liam and sure enough, he had already taken them down swiftly. 

I sighed. These guys were going to learn a lesson they will never forget. Liam wasn't going to hold back.

The two men were guarding a steel door which Liam quickly opened, making a screeching sound which made me cringe. I followed quickly behind him, and each time we saw someone, it took only a moment for them to drop dead on the floor. 

"Hey, leave some action for me." I complained as I checked the pulse of one of the men that fell down. Liam said nothing. He was too fixated on saving his son. 

We continued until we reached the furthest room of the basement. Unfortunately, this time, there were about five people guarding the door, talking amongst themselves. Liam and I stayed low and hidden from them. I looked over to Liam and nodded. He was there, Jace was surely there. 

We waited for a while, listening to their conversation. 

"Is the kid fed?" 

Bingo. 

"Nah, he doesn't wanna touch the food." 

"Maybe he wants McDonalds instead." 

"So what happened to him?" 

"When the boss didn't receive anything this morning, he made Alvez beat the kid up." 

I quickly glanced over to Liam whose eyes went ablaze and face turned dark. Well, there goes the plan of keeping them alive. 

Liam got up from where he was hiding and quickly attacked the five men. All of their eyes widened at the surprise and raised their weapons at him. Some started shooting their hand guns, but Liam was able to dodge them. I stepped out of the darkness to help Liam, knocking some of the opponents' guns out of their possessions. 

Some of the men whimpered in fear and were about to screamed for help, when Liam kicked at their throats to keep them from screaming. 

"Leave them alive, Ezra. These scums don't deserve a quick death." Liam said darkly which surprised me since he wasn't the type to torture people. He always thought that it was a waste of time. 

Without delay, he opened the door. 

Some men from inside probably heard what was happening from outside and as soon as the door opened, bullets started raining down. Unfortunately for them, Liam and I were hidden from both sides of the door and when the bullets subsided, we quickly entered by attacking the men in front of the door. 

The room was dimly lit, thus hindering us from completely seeing our surroundings. Out of nowhere, men attacked, but they were weak and quickly brought down. My eyes scanned the room for a child, but the light was too dim for me to be able to see someone. It must have been the same case for Liam since he didn't move from his spot, but simply looking around him. 

As I took out a small flashlight from my pocket, someone emerged from the darkness with a gun pointed to a... child. 

I quickly noted the child's appearance which was almost a replica of Liam, save for the child's golden hair. However, it was his eyes that assured me that he inherited it from his father. A light shade of green, reminding me of the refreshing nature. If I met him in any other circumstances, I'm sure his eyes would have amazed me more, but the fear that was stricken on face was unforgettable. 

The side of his lip was stained with purple, a sign that he had been beat up. His face had a few bruises where dry blood was clearly seen. Over his body were more patches of purple and bruises. His clothes were dirty, and he was missing a shoe, his white sock now a muddy colour. 

"Sick bastards, beating and torturing a kid." I whispered. 

The man that held him hostage looked just as scared. 

"D-don't come closer! I-if you come any closer, I-I-I'll finish him off!" he screamed. Jace's face reddened and tears started rolling down. I only noticed then that his eyes were puffy and tired. Poor kid must have cried a lot. 

Liam was silent as he slowly walked towards the two of them.

"I said d-don't come closer!" the man said again, this time, sounding even more scared. He pointed the gun closer to Jace's head which made Liam stop on his track for a short moment before speeding to the middle-aged man, firstly knocking his gun off his hand, taking it from him and pointing it to him. 

"Let the kid go or I'll shoot." he said so coldly, it sent shivers down my spine. The man must have sensed the bloodlust in his voice and aura and quickly let go of Jace. 

The kid dropped to the ground as he started sobbing. Liam seemed to be snapped from his bloodlust trance and looked down. He looked at Jace with such gentleness and frailness, as if afraid that one wrong look will break him. 

Liam threw the gun and kneeled down, picking Jace onto his arms and carrying him. I could see the mixture of hurt and pity in Liam's eyes. He momentarily glanced at me and I quickly understood what he was trying to say. I smiled.

"Don't worry, I'll make sure they all regret what they did."
